Briefly comprising of two double bedrooms, family bathroom, additional cloakroom WC, separate kitchen and a spacious living room which leads directly into the private enclosed garden. Externally are allocated parking space for two cars.
The location manages to offer superb convenience, access to amenities, proximity to major employers, Bristol Parkway Station nearby and all whilst offering the benefits of this sought-after residential area.

Great Meadow Road
Entrance
The attractive entrance is instantly inviting especially given the hedgerow to the front aspect. A modern glazed door leads inwards.Hallway
The hallway instantly gives a feeling of space and light. The contemporary wood effect flooring extends from here into all ground floor room granting a feeling of unity and similarly the light is shared from the living room and kitchen.Kitchen
8' 2" max x 6' 1" max ( 2.49m max x 1.85m max )Again, very well presented! The contemporary kitchen includes wall and base units in gloss grey with contracting worktops. The space includes an integrated oven and hob, brushed steel splashback, sink and drainer plus space for the fridge-freezer and undercounter washing machine. The window to the front offers a pleasant outlook and associated light.
Living Room
13' 9" max x 13' 3" max ( 4.19m max x 4.04m max )WOW! This lovely room benefits from garden views and oodles of light as elsewhere. The sizable dimensions also include the open-space under the stairs which can be used to great effect and complements the decor complements the general contemporary feel of the home.
Cloakroom W.C
Stylish....useful....functional. Complete with a window to the front aspect, WC and basin.Stairs Leading Upwards
Presented well with bare wood stair treads alongside painted banister and spindles. ** The top floor has stripped wooden floorboard throughout which look great.Bedroom 1
10' 7" max x 9' 11" max ( 3.23m max x 3.02m max )Well proportioned double bedroom to include extensive fitted storage, garden views and beautiful wooden flooring. Plenty of space for additional furniture.
Bedroom 2
7' 11" max x 6' 8" max ( 2.41m max x 2.03m max )Again, well proportioned for a room of it's type and presented very well with wooden flooring. Light and views to the front aspect.
Bathroom
6' 5" max x 5' 7" max ( 1.96m max x 1.70m max )Well presented and contemporary three-piece bathroom to include shower over bath with glass screen, radiator, extractor and forward facing window.
External
Garden
The garden feels exceptionally private given its position and includes lawn and paved which is perfect for socialising and alfresco dining. The favourable orientation offers beautiful sunlight and a wonderful place to relax.Parking
Parking for two cars to the front beyond the pretty hedgerow.Agents Notes
